重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 开发商城类app(商城类APP开发过程中常见的技术难点有哪些?)

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

开发商城类app(商城类APP开发过程中常见的技术难点有哪些?)

时间:2024-10-25 11:49:00来源:安菲云科技阅读:241025
开发商城类APP是一项复杂而系统的工程,需要综合考虑市场需求、用户体验、技术实现等多个方面。本文将从商城APP的类型、功能模块、开发流程和注意事项等方面进行详细阐述。一、商城APP的类型商城APP可以根据其功能和服务对象的不同,分为以下几类:电商类商城APP:如淘宝、京东、天猫等,主要提供商品购买、

开发商城类APP是一项复杂而系统的工程,需要综合考虑市场需求、用户体验、技术实现等多个方面。本文将从商城APP的类型、功能模块、开发流程和注意事项等方面进行详细阐述。

一、商城APP的类型

商城APP可以根据其功能和服务对象的不同,分为以下几类:

  1. 电商类商城APP:如淘宝、京东、天猫等,主要提供商品购买、支付、物流等服务。
  2. 社交类商城APP:如微信、微博、抖音等,这类APP通过社交互动促进商品销售。
  3. 垂直类商城APP:专注于某一特定领域的商品销售,如母婴用品、电子产品等。
  4. 综合类商城APP:集成了多种功能和服务,满足用户多样化的需求。

二、商城APP的功能模块

一个完整的商城APP通常包括以下功能模块:

  1. 用户注册与登录:支持多种注册和登录方式,如手机号、邮箱、第三方账号等。
  2. 商品展示与搜索:提供丰富的商品展示和强大的搜索功能,方便用户快速找到所需商品。
  3. 购物车与订单管理:用户可以将商品加入购物车,并进行订单的创建、支付和管理。
  4. 支付系统:集成多种支付方式,如支付宝、微信支付、银行卡支付等。
  5. 物流跟踪:提供物流信息的实时跟踪,方便用户了解商品的配送状态。
  6. 用户评价与反馈:用户可以对购买的商品进行评价,并提供反馈意见。
  7. 促销与优惠:支持各种促销活动和优惠券的发放,吸引用户购买。

三、商城APP的开发流程

开发一个商城APP通常需要经过以下几个步骤:

  1. 需求分析:明确APP的目标用户和市场需求,确定功能模块和技术方案。
  2. 原型设计:根据需求分析结果,进行APP的原型设计,确定界面布局和交互方式。
  3. UI设计:设计美观、易用的用户界面,提升用户体验。
  4. 前端开发:使用HTML、CSS、JavaScript等技术实现APP的前端界面。
  5. 后端开发:搭建服务器,开发API接口,处理数据存储和业务逻辑。
  6. 测试与优化:对APP进行全面测试,发现并修复问题,优化性能和用户体验。
  7. 上线与维护:将APP发布到应用市场,并进行后续的维护和更新。

四、开发商城APP的注意事项

在开发商城APP的过程中,需要注意以下几点:

  1. 用户体验:始终以用户为中心,设计简洁、易用的界面和流畅的操作流程。
  2. 安全性:确保用户数据和交易信息的安全,防止信息泄露和支付风险。
  3. 性能优化:优化APP的加载速度和响应时间,提升用户体验。
  4. 兼容性:确保APP在不同设备和操作系统上的兼容性,提供一致的用户体验。
  5. 持续更新:根据用户反馈和市场变化,持续更新和优化APP,保持竞争力。

总之,开发一个成功的商城APP需要综合考虑多个方面,从需求分析到上线维护,每一个环节都至关重要。通过不断优化和改进,才能打造出用户满意的商城APP。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:开发电商城app(电商城APP开发过程中常见的技术难点有哪些?)

下一篇:开发个商城app(商城APP开发过程中常见的技术难点有哪些?)

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询